Chimney Inspection and Sweep Process

Here's Exactly What We Do

First, our technician inspects your entire chimney system from top to bottom. We check the flue, damper, firebox, and exterior structure. You’ll know exactly what condition everything is in before any work begins.

Next comes the actual cleaning. Using professional-grade brushes and vacuum systems, we remove all creosote, soot, and debris from the flue. The process is thorough but contained – no mess in your home.

Finally, you get a detailed report of what was found and what was done. If any issues need attention, you’ll know about them upfront. No surprises, no pressure, just the facts about your chimney’s condition.

How often should I have my chimney swept and cleaned?

The National Fire Protection Association recommends annual chimney cleaning for most homeowners. If you use your fireplace regularly throughout the winter, once a year is essential. Even if you only use it occasionally, an annual inspection ensures everything stays in safe working condition. Garden City’s coastal environment can accelerate deterioration, making regular maintenance even more important. The best time to schedule is late summer or early fall, before you start using your fireplace for the season.
A professional chimney sweep always includes both cleaning and inspection – they go hand in hand. The inspection happens first, checking for structural issues, blockages, or damage. Then comes the cleaning, removing creosote, soot, and debris. During cleaning, we often discover issues that weren’t visible during the initial inspection. You need both services to ensure your chimney is truly safe and functional. Some companies try to separate these services, but a proper job includes both components.
Most homeowners in Garden City pay between $150-300 for a standard chimney cleaning and inspection. The exact cost depends on your chimney’s height, condition, and accessibility. Chimneys that haven’t been cleaned in several years may require additional work. You’ll always get an upfront estimate before any work begins – no surprise charges or hidden fees. The investment is minimal compared to the cost of fire damage or major chimney repairs that result from neglect.
Professional chimney sweeps use specialized equipment to contain all debris and soot. Modern vacuum systems and drop cloths keep your home clean throughout the process. We protect your floors and furniture before starting work. Most of the actual cleaning happens from the roof down, with powerful vacuums capturing everything before it enters your living space. You might notice a slight odor during the work, but there shouldn’t be any visible mess or cleanup required afterward.
Chimney cleaning requires specialized tools, safety equipment, and knowledge of what to look for. Professional technicians are trained to identify structural problems, proper ventilation issues, and safety hazards that untrained homeowners miss. The roof work alone is dangerous without proper equipment and experience. Most importantly, insurance companies may not cover fire damage if you haven’t maintained proper professional maintenance records. The cost of professional service is minimal compared to the risks of DIY chimney work.
If any issues are discovered, you’ll get a detailed explanation of what we found and what it means for your safety. Minor problems like small cracks or loose dampers are common and usually inexpensive to fix. More serious issues like structural damage or major blockages require immediate attention. You’ll never be pressured into expensive repairs on the spot. Instead, you’ll get clear information about what needs to be addressed, what’s urgent versus what can wait, and recommendations for qualified repair contractors if needed.
